Need lowest actual temps achievable by various upright freezers.

no rule of thumb
maybe if you got a different thermostat that has a lower setting than standard
however as upright freezers are very bad freezers compared to chest type freezers the lowest reading will be around the -35 degrees C
Why very bad -- every time you open the door you dump 20 degrees out onto the floor and the temp difference is more pronounced than opening the lid of a chest unit which keeps all of the cold in the unit
remember the colder the setting the more the compressor is working

Replacing true kegerator parts

no use a Ranco p# A12-700 make sure the capillary is in the coilto sense the temp and set it to 1.5 on the knob. any colder and it could get too cold . you may be able to set it at 2 but be careful. it is a constant cut in at 37 degrees coil temp. the box temp will drop to usually to 28 or 29 at cut out.

How do I test the temperature control module for a kenmore freezer model 253.9284013

You need a multi-meter to do this. The temp.control is just a switch that closes on temperature rise and opens on temperaure fall (or when it reaches the desired temperature). Using a meter set on ohms coneect to the 2 prong ends of the temp. control. Set the temp. control on off. You should not have any ohms because hte temp. control is open (no continunity) now set the temp control to 2 or 3 and it should close (the meter will read ohms or continunity)
if it does then the t'stat works. The only other exception is the temp. control will sometimes (this is rare) not properly sense temp. for example, it fails to sense zero degrees and it will either stay on too long to shut off too soon. I only seen this happen like twice in 20 years. but more or less this is how you do it!!!
